Stuff is a tough one because it's not like an alcoholic avoiding bars or the wine aisle at the grocery store. Stuff is needed in our homes and will always be needed. The secret is not "swearing off" stuff, or stores but learning to create a healthy balance with the stuff we have so that every item we have is consciously in our homes and lives for a reason that supports us.

Hi Esther, do you know about the following services that offer free pick up? You can call and set your items outside your door. Some will take them right out of your storage unit. You will have to decide in advance which items to keep and which ones they can take. That way they are not waiting on you to decide. But if you are not looking to get money for your items, you can have them come get it now. • Salvation Army • Goodwill • AMVETS National Service Foundation • Habitat for Humanity • The Arc • Pickup Please • Furniture Bank Network • PickUpMyDonation.com

Hi Sandra, whatever works best for you. I'm a "take one type of item out" at a time. This way I can quickly sort, scale down and organize what is left of one item. The rest of my closet is still intact and I haven't made a mess. You have to do what works with your personality. If I made a big pile, I would just overwhelm myself. LOL. :-)
